    Senior Manager – Customer Data Privacy

    • We are pleased to announce the following vacancy for Senior Manager – Customer Data Privacy within Customer Privacy Department in Corporate Security Division. In keeping with our current business needs, we are looking for a person who meets the criteria indicated below.

    Description

    Reporting to the HOD – Customer Privacy , the role holder will; 

    • Enhance data protection capacity across the organization in order to strengthen privacy by design. 
    • Define appropriate data protection and privacy policies and procedures.
    • Coordinate and delivers timely risk assessments and data protection KPI reporting for Safaricom Plc.
    • Develop and implements Data Protection compliance framework across stakeholders with applicable national and international laws and regulations pertaining to data protection and privacy.
    • Develop and rolls out appropriate training and awareness programmes to enforce a strong culture of data protection across stakeholders. 
    • Prepare regulatory engagement submissions referring to and collaborating with appropriate internal stakeholders

    R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Work with stakeholders to maintain records of Safaricom Plc’s data processing activities, in conjunction with subsidiary management 
    •  Provide advice and review compliance  to Data Protection Impact Assessments (DPIAs) requirements
    • Monitor data management procedures and compliance within Safaricom Plc 
    • Develop and share advice and guidelines for implementing privacy by design and privacy by default in all products and systems
    • Ensure all queries from data subjects seeking to exercise their rights are responded to within required timeframes 
    • Develop  and update detailed guidelines via data protection policies and define required contractual provisions to enforce data sharing obligations
    • Develop and implement annual training and awareness programmes for all stakeholders. 

    QUALIFICATIONS

    • A legal qualification is key for this role. Business or IT security degrees also considered.
    • Privacy certifications such as CIPP/E and ISO 27701 an added advantage
